摘要
A Nd:YAG laser pumped by a Kr-flashlamp with simultaneous dual-wavelength operation at 1357 nm (F-4(3/2) -> I-4(13/2)(R-1 -> X-4)) and 1444 nm (F-4(3/2) -> I-4(13/2)(R-1 -> X-7)) is demonstrated and its characteristics was analyzed. The output energy of 82 m] at 1357 nm and 138 mJ at 1444 nm were achieved simultaneously with the maximum electrical input energy of 44J. Stability of the output energy in the dual-wavelength operation was 1.41% at the maximum input energy of 44J. However, the stabilities at each wavelength in the dual-wavelength operation showed much lower stability. (C) 2008 Elsevier B.V. All rights reserved.
